Trends in Duplex and Super Duplex Stainless Steel Welding Wires

Duplex and super duplex stainless steel welding wires are gaining traction ahead of the 2026 Canton Fair. These materials stand out for their excellent corrosion resistance and strength. Industries such as oil and gas, marine, and chemical processing are increasingly turning to these advanced alloys. The performance benefits they offer cannot be overlooked.

However, there are challenges. Matching the right welding technique with these wires is crucial. Improper settings can compromise weld quality. For instance, high heat input may lead to unwanted phase changes in the metal structure. It’s essential to focus on proper training to ensure effective welding.
